Cork County Council has been notified of funding for a number of projects under the 2017 Outdoor Recreation Infrastructure Scheme in recent day by the Department of Rural and Community Development. The Scheme provides for the development of new outdoor recreational infrastructure and the maintenance, enhancement and promotion of existing outdoor recreational infrastructure.
In North Cork, Mallow’s Sli Na Slainte 3.4km loop walk is to receive minor repair works and improved signage while the Killavullen Loop Upgrade, Ballard Waterfall Trail Upgrade & Blackwater Way will all receive marketing assistance.
Within the county, a total of 12 projects have received funding of up to €10,000 each which will involve Cork County Council working with local communities to enhance local amenities, demonstrating the strong working relationship between the Council and local groups. In addition to these projects, €1 million has been awarded to the Cork Harbour Greenway project where it is proposed to extend existing greenway facilities by commencing the development of a link that will connect Glenbrook to Carrigaline to provide for a harbour-long greenway.
Commenting on the announcement today, Cllr. Declan Hurley, Mayor of the County of Cork, welcomed the funding award, noting the positive contribution that investment in such amenities makes to local communities as well as to the tourism potential of the county.
“Securing funding of € 1 million for the Cork Harbour Greenway project is a significant step towards the development of the link that will connect the greenway paths between Carrigaline and Crosshaven and between Passage West and the City for the benefit of local communities, wider Metropolitan Cork and visitors to the county.”
